Schools across the nation are using this week to indoctrinate students with progressive activism using a curriculum promoted by the Black Lives Matter (BLM) movement, a parent group warns. During the “Black Lives Matter at School Week of Action,” which kicked off Monday, public school districts from Boston to Seattle will teach lessons that corresponded to core BLM values, such as “Diversity and Globalism” on Tuesday, and “Trans-Affirming, Queer Affirming, and Collective Value” on Wednesday. The lessons are based on 13 “Black Lives Matter Guiding Principles,” including a call for “Black Villages,” which is “the disruption of Western nuclear family dynamics and a return to the ‘collective village’ that takes care of each other,” and a commitment to “dismantle cisgender privilege and uplift Black trans folk.” “Everybody has the right to choose their own gender by listening to their own heart and mind.
